Nobody Listens to the Words Anyway

I heard about these language removal people on NPR earlier this week. The Language Removal Service has produced audio tapes of speech by leading candidates in the California gubernatorial election…with all the words removed. All that's left is breathing noises, “um's”, “ah's” and the like. They played some of their tapes on the radio, and you can hear them at their website. I found it deeply weird, especially given the utterly dead-pan way in which the guy describing it kept calling it a 'service to the public' as if the results were revelatory of something essential about the speaker's character. He was very good—it was hard to tell if he was a prankster, a Dadaist, or a new species of loon.

I deeply pray that no one ever does one of those to my lectures.
